The NXP MK12DN512VLK5R microcontroller is a highly capable and versatile component designed for a wide range of applications. It is part of the Kinetis K series, which is known for its exceptional performance, power efficiency, and rich suite of peripherals. This microcontroller is based on ARM Cortex-M4 core technology, offering a perfect blend of efficiency and processing power.
Key Features:
- Core: ARM Cortex-M4 with Floating Point Unit (FPU), running at frequencies up to 100 MHz.
- Memory: Equipped with 512 KB flash memory and 64 KB RAM, it provides ample space for complex applications.
- Communication Interfaces: Multiple communication options including I2C, SPI, UART, and USB, enabling easy integration with a variety of peripherals and systems.
- Analog Modules: Features several analog components such as 16-bit ADCs, 12-bit DACs, and analog comparators, providing excellent interfacing for sensors and other analog devices.
- Timers: A rich set of timers including PWM, Real-Time Clock, and Periodic Interrupt Timers, which are essential for precise timing operations and event management.
- Security and Integrity: Includes hardware CRC (Cyclic Redundancy Check) module and Memory Protection Unit (MPU) to ensure data integrity and security.
- Low Power Consumption: Designed for energy-sensitive applications, it supports various power-saving modes to minimize energy usage without sacrificing performance.
- Packaging: Available in a 80-pin LQFP package, it provides a compact footprint while offering sufficient I/O options for complex designs.
